Be Forgiving
"And be kind to one another, tenderhearted , forgiving one another, even as God forgave you ( Ephesians 4:32)
Something all believers tend to struggle with is forgiveness, especially if someone upsets us and shows no remorse,which in our eyes may make them unworthy of our forgiveness, however the Bible is full of stories about people who had to learn to forgive.
One of the best examples of forgiveness in the Bible is Esau who forgave his twin brother Jacob despite his deception (Genesis 27).
The bible says that “Then Esau ran to meet him (Jacob) and embraced him, and fell on his neck and kissed him, and they wept”.(Genesis 33:4).
We also read of how Joseph forgave his brothers (Genesis 50:15-21) and how Hosea forgave his wife repeatedly despite her betrayal of him (Hosea 1-3) and there are many more acts of forgiveness spread throughout the bible.
However, of all the acts of forgiveness in the bible the greatest of all has to be that of Jesus Christ who shed His blood so that we could have redemption and forgiveness of sins. Our forgiveness from God is a measure of how we should forgive others as The Lord taught us'”And forgive us our debts, as we also have forgiven our debtors (Matthew 6:12).
